Output f7507e3060c927067523c925d4e1462f9fa90fcc449590b1cb1a40f9200063e2:0

value
260279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cb540e235cb94e2e3df06cfacef97160540bbdb OP_EQUAL
address
32rDAZDjM9TXNB6PtQzafBxD8fbCsW2hg7
transaction
f7507e3060c927067523c925d4e1462f9fa90fcc449590b1cb1a40f9200063e2
confirmations
177196
spent
true